The thing about Anoka is the southern third is pretty DFL and the northern third is pretty Republican. They offset each other quite a bit and then it comes down to the middle third of the county, which is more split. I'd still say it leans GOP, but it depends where WWC people go. It's a bit unique from the rest of the metro in how working class it is (unlike Carver or Hennepin where the suburbs can be more white collar)
